Transaction 07313077e15d5093dc538b8aeaca9a348f0504ef7f7447f37e7620fa1b4a38e3
1 Input
1 Output
-
07313077e15d5093dc538b8aeaca9a348f0504ef7f7447f37e7620fa1b4a38e3:0
- value
- 4995488
- script pubkey
- OP_0 OP_PUSHBYTES_20 58a913bd9e692bf15cfb58752da9bf40e55a6309
- address
- bc1qtz5380v7dy4lzh8mtp6jm2dlgrj45ccfdqx9y9